操作
补丁¶
补丁文件是一个包含对Redmine所有更改的单个文件。它是创建和共享Redmine更改的首选方式。
创建补丁文件¶
创建Redmine补丁很简单。只需遵循以下简单步骤
- 下载Redmine的开发副本
- 进行您的更改
- 在Redmine文件夹中运行
svn diff > PATCH_NAME.diff
。将PATCH_NAME改为描述目的的名称。 - 将补丁文件上传到问题并共享
应用补丁文件¶
要应用补丁文件,您可以使用patch程序。
- 切换到您的Redmine目录(包含app、test和config文件夹的目录)
- 运行
patch -p0 < PATCH_NAME.diff
- 检查消息中是否有任何错误。
一些错误可能是因为对相同代码区域的更改。如果您熟悉合并代码,您可以尝试合并更改。否则,在您下载补丁的地方或论坛中寻求帮助。
移除补丁文件¶
要移除补丁文件,您可以使用patch程序。
- 切换到您的Redmine目录(包含app、test和config文件夹的目录)
- 运行
patch -p0 -R < PATCH_NAME.diff
- 检查消息中是否有任何错误。